Whenever someone wants to introduce some color into a home, I recommend a 3-color palette. Next, follow the designer’s color rule of dividing the colors into percentages: 60% dominant color, 30% secondary color, and 10% accent color. It’s really easy and fabulous! Picture below shows the neutral, cream/beige as the dominant, chartreuse green as the secondary, and plum as the accent.
